Description

Otherton Farmhouse is a circa 1800 farmhouse located in Penkridge, Staffordshire. It is constructed of red brick with a plain tile roof and features a brick ridge stack. The farmhouse is three storeys high and has three windows, each with casement glazing and segmental heads. A central door provides access.
